The Magic Of Acid-Etching: Transforming Surfaces With Precision

acid-etching is a technique that has been used for centuries to transform surfaces with precision. From metal to glass and even teeth, acid-etching offers a versatile and effective way to create intricate designs and textures. This process involves using acid to create a microscopically rough surface, which allows for better adhesion and bonding when applying paint, enamel, or other coatings.

The history of acid-etching dates back to the Middle Ages, where it was used primarily on metal surfaces for decorative purposes. The technique involves applying a resist material, such as wax or varnish, to the surface to protect areas that are not intended to be etched. The acid is then applied to the exposed areas, creating a frosted or textured finish. This process can be repeated multiple times to achieve the desired depth of etching.

One of the most common uses of acid-etching is in the creation of printed circuit boards (PCBs). PCBs are essential components in electronic devices, providing a platform for mounting and connecting electronic components. acid-etching is used to remove unwanted copper from the board, leaving behind the desired circuit pattern. The acid eats away at the unprotected copper, creating a precise and reliable circuit layout.

In dentistry, acid-etching is used to prepare teeth for bonding with fillings or veneers. The acid creates a rough surface on the enamel, allowing for better adhesion of the dental material. This helps to ensure a strong bond between the tooth and the filling, increasing the longevity and effectiveness of the restoration. acid-etching is a crucial step in modern dentistry, providing a reliable and long-lasting solution for tooth restoration.

Glass is another material that can be beautifully enhanced through acid-etching. By applying acid to the surface of the glass, intricate designs and patterns can be created. This process can be used to create decorative glassware, windows, and even art installations. Acid-etched glass offers a unique and elegant finish that is both durable and visually appealing.

In the world of art and design, acid-etching is a popular technique for creating prints and illustrations. Artists use acid to eat away at the surface of metal plates, creating sunken areas that hold ink. When the plate is pressed onto paper, the ink is transferred, creating a print. This process allows for the creation of intricate and detailed designs that can be reproduced multiple times.

Acid-etching is also used in the manufacturing of metal parts and components. By using acid to remove surface material, manufacturers can create precise and detailed shapes with tight tolerances. This process is commonly used in the aerospace and automotive industries, where precision and reliability are paramount. Acid-etching allows for the creation of complex parts that would be difficult or impossible to produce using traditional methods.

One of the key benefits of acid-etching is its ability to create a strong bond between materials. By roughening the surface, the acid creates microscopic nooks and crannies that provide more surface area for adhesion. This results in a stronger bond that is less likely to peel or flake over time.
